The Gate of Silver was the fifth of the Seven Gates of Gondolin.
History
The Gate of Silver possessed the shape of a low and broad wall of white marble spanning the Orfalch Echor. The parapet was a trellis of silver between five great globes of marble. The white-robed archers that guarded the gate were stationed here. The gate was in shape as three parts of a circle, and wrought of silver and pearl of Nevrast, in the likeness of the Moon. Above the gate upon the midmost globe was an image of the white Tree Telperion, wrought of silver and malachite, with flowers made of great pearls of Balar. Beyond the gate was a wide, green and white, marble court where there were two hundred archers in silver mail and white-crested helms. There were a hundred on each side, possibly being members of the Guard of some captain or chieftain. They later had some representation at the high sward overlooking Tumladen under the Warden of the Great Gate. This gate followed the Gate of Writhen Iron and was followed by the Gate of Gold.[1]
